Affogato al Caffe {Affogato}

If you like espresso and you like gelato {or ice cream} then this dessert is for you. Affogato means “drowned” in Italian, which is exactly what you are doing to the gelato/ice cream with the hot and steamy espresso. I never know whether to eat it with a spoon or a straw so I use both ; )  I even like to up the ante by adding a shot of Amaretto {and the only Amaretto for me is Amaretto di Saronno}

Negroni

There are a few classic Italian cocktails, the Negroni is on that short list. It’s said to have originated in Florence as a twist to the Americano cocktail. It’s an aperitif which is meant to be enjoyed prior to dinner to stimulate the appetite {not that I have any problem with that}. And while I was in ROMA recently we did just that.
